Abstract

This article analyses the impact of Self-Exploration and Transformation Tourism Theory on tourist arrivals in Krui, West Pesisir Regency, Lampung. The background of this research is the tourism potential of Krui, which is famous for its beautiful beaches and rich local culture. The method used is a descriptive qualitative approach with in-depth interviews and direct observation. The results showed that tourism in Krui experienced an increase in visits after the COVID-19 pandemic, fuelled by various promotional initiatives and improved facilities. The self-exploration and transformation theory of tourism is relevant to Krui, as the tourism experience there can support tourists' self-reflection and personal growth. Interaction with the natural environment and local culture in Krui provides a deep and meaningful experience in line with the principles of this theory. This article highlights the importance of sustainable tourism management to maintain a balance between economic benefits and environmental conservation..
